Subject: [PATCH 05/10] convert/sub-process: drop cast to hashmap_cmp_fn

convert.c | 3 +--
sub-process.c | 7 +++++--
sub-process.h | 4 ++--
3 files changed, 8 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
diff --git a/convert.c b/convert.c
index deaf0ba7b3..04966c723c 100644
--- a/convert.c
+++ b/convert.c
@@ -583,8 +583,7 @@ static int apply_multi_file_filter(const char *path, const char *src, size_t len
if (!subprocess_map_initialized) {
subprocess_map_initialized = 1;
- hashmap_init(&subprocess_map, (hashmap_cmp_fn) cmd2process_cmp,
- NULL, 0);
+ hashmap_init(&subprocess_map, cmd2process_cmp, NULL, 0);
entry = NULL;
} else {
entry = (struct cmd2process *)subprocess_find_entry(&subprocess_map, cmd);
diff --git a/sub-process.c b/sub-process.c
index a3cfab1a9d..6cbffa4406 100644
--- a/sub-process.c
+++ b/sub-process.c
@@ -6,10 +6,13 @@
#include "pkt-line.h"
int cmd2process_cmp(const void *unused_cmp_data,
- const struct subprocess_entry *e1,
- const struct subprocess_entry *e2,
+ const void *entry,
+ const void *entry_or_key,
const void *unused_keydata)
{
+ const struct subprocess_entry *e1 = entry;
+ const struct subprocess_entry *e2 = entry_or_key;
+
return strcmp(e1->cmd, e2->cmd);
}
diff --git a/sub-process.h b/sub-process.h
index 96a2cca360..8cd07a59ab 100644
--- a/sub-process.h
+++ b/sub-process.h
@@ -21,8 +21,8 @@ struct subprocess_entry {
/* subprocess functions */
extern int cmd2process_cmp(const void *unused_cmp_data,
- const struct subprocess_entry *e1,
- const struct subprocess_entry *e2,
+ const void *e1,
+ const void *e2,
const void *unused_keydata);
typedef int(*subprocess_start_fn)(struct subprocess_entry *entry);
